In computer science, data mapping is the process of connecting data elements in one database or file to their counterparts in another. It is a key component of data integration, and helps ensure that information can be properly transferred from one system to another.

Data mapping can be used to convert data from one format to another, or to connect data that is stored in different places. In either case, the goal is to create a consistent view of the data that can be used by various applications or processes.

1. Define the scope of your project:

The first step in any data mapping project is to define the scope of the work that needs to be done. This will help you to identify the specific goals of the project, as well as the resources that will be required to complete it.

Some questions that you may want to consider include:

  • What types of data need to be mapped?
  • Where is this data located?
  • What is the format of the data?
  • How will the data be used?
  • What are the specific goals of the project?

2. Identify the source and destination of your data:

The next step is to identify where your data is coming from, and where it needs to go. This will help you to determine the best way to connect the two systems.

Some questions that you may want to consider include:

  • What is the structure of the source data?
  • What is the structure of the destination data?
  • How are the two systems connected?
  • What is the best way to transfer the data?

3. Determine the format of your data:

The next step is to determine the format of your data. This will help you to choose the right data mapping tool for the job.

Some questions that you may want to consider include:

  • What is the structure of the data?
  • What are the specific requirements for the project?
  • How complex is the data?

4. Choose a data mapping tool:

There are many different types of data mapping tools available, and the one that you choose will depend on the specific needs of your project. Some common options include ETL tools, data integration platforms, and code generators.
